More than a little dangerous. The nigriventer and the fera are extremly toxic. This is absolutely a Phoneutria species, and I would lean towards the nigriventer. Beautiful spider, but be careful!
 
The Brazilian wandering spiders appear in Guinness World Records 2007 as the world's most venomous spiders, and are considered to be responsible for the most human deaths due to envenomation from spider bites.[1]
